Divetech in Grand Cayman, Cayman Islands, is seeking qualified Boat Captains for immediate vacancies. Applicants must be scuba instructors in good standing from a major training agency. Applicants should also have experience operating single screw inboard drive vessels without bow thrusters. Strong mechanical aptitude is a must.

Divetech offers the following compensation for it’s employees
  • 5 day per week work schedule (2 days off every week)
  • Tips
  • Extra pay for night dives
  • Extra pay for 5-star TripAdvisor reviews
  • Health insurance
  • Paid sick leave
  • Optional dental insurance
  • 2 weeks paid vacation annually
  • 13 paid holidays annually - either extra pay or extra days off
  • Lieu days for extra time worked
  • Pension contributions
  • Uniforms
  • Salary commensurate with experience
  • Option to use group liability insurance
Divetech believes strongly in career and instructor development, and is a great place to learn. Divetech constantly offers opportunities to expand your certifications and instructor ratings, on both a paid and unpaid basis.

Training opportunities includes:
  • Instructor Development - the opportunity to become an instructor in technical diving, or freediving
  • Technical dive training, including sidemount, and trimix
  • Rebreather training, including air and helium diluents
  • Use of Divetech rental rebreathers for both guided dives and personal use
  • Freedive training
  • Gas blender training
  • Boat captain training
Divetech operates out of 3 locations. Employees rotate assignments daily, and will find themselves instructing classes, guiding dives, filling tanks, staffing retail shops, conducting repairs and crewing boats. In addition, employees may be assigned to maintenance tasks, such as repairs, servicing, tank visual inspection, or other specialty assignments as needed. During an average week, an employee will find themselves in-water conducting training classes, or guiding dives 2-3 days. Work days are generally 7:30 AM to 5:00 PM.
